ParisNext · 18/07/2018 19:26

I've done this a few times and you have to book the ticket (some like BA force you to book an adult ticket) then you call them and they link your reservation numbers andxhanfe the reference to a child. I then received a refund for the lower price due to the air tax being reduced. Sounds complicated but it was quite simple.
